Transaction 757313cee727d9ed3e6c3c85813f1174e7faf9808ca41cc895b4dd8ca09580e0
2 Input
1 Outputs
- 757313cee727d9ed3e6c3c85813f1174e7faf9808ca41cc895b4dd8ca09580e0:0
value 4286820
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G